摘要
在LTE系统小区搜索中,当实现定时同步和频率同步后,需要检测CP类型以及小区组标识,从而实现帧同步和获得小区ID.文章提出了一种首先利用SSS的对称性进行CP检测后进行SSS检测的算法,降低了原有算法的复杂度。SSS检测算法通过使用子帧0和子帧5的辅同步信号的联合检测,提高了算法的性能。仿真结果显示,该算法具有良好的检测性能和较低的复杂度。
In the cell search of the LTE systems, in order to achieve frame synchronization and obtain the cell ID, when achieve timing synchronization and frequency synchronization, the UE needs to detect the CP type and the physical-layer cell identity group. In general, it is complex to detect with a correlation operation between the received secondary synchronization signal in according with different cp type and the local secondary synchronization signal. To achieve low complexity, we propose an algorithm that detects the type of cp previously using the SSS symmetry and then detects SSS. The SSS detection algorithm adopts the joint detection by using the subframe 0 and subframe 5 to improve the performance of the algorithm. The simulation results show that the proposed algorithm has a good detection performance and lower complexity.
